all: show git id in --version information
In order to be able to better track regressions or to give support, let us track the Git id as well in version information. This makes the ``--version'' switch actually useful. Signed-off-by: Daniel Borkmann <dborkman@redhat.com>

Similarly, for the old non GAS register, it is supposed that its Address should be aligned to its Length. For the "AccessSize = 0 (meaning ANY)" case, we try to return the maximum instruction width (64 for MMIO or 32 for PIO) or the user expected access bit width (64 for acpi_read()/acpi_write() or 32 for acpi_hw_read()/ acpi_hw_write()) and it is supposed that the GAS Address field should always be aligned to the maximum expected access bit width (otherwise it can't be accessed using ANY access bit width). The problem is in acpi_tb_init_generic_address(), where the non GAS register's Length is converted into the GAS BitWidth field, its Address is converted into the GAS Address field, and the GAS AccessSize field is left 0 but most of the registers actually cannot be accessed using "ANY" accesses. As a conclusion, when AccessSize = 0 (ANY), the Address should either be aligned to the BitWidth (wrong conversion) or aligned to 32 for PIO or 64 for MMIO (real GAS). Since currently, max_bit_width is 32, then: 1. BitWidth for the wrong conversion is 8,16,32; and 2. The Address of the real GAS should always be aligned to 8,16,32. The address alignment check to exclude false matched real GAS is not necessary. Thus this patch fixes the issue by removing the address alignment check. On the other hand, we in fact could use a simpler check of "reg->bit_width < max_bit_width" to exclude the "BitWidth=64 PIO" case that may be issued from acpi_read()/acpi_write() in the future.
